GREEN GODDESS DRESSING



Green Goddess Dressing image

Green goddess has been around for about a hundred years, but it's arguably more popular now than it has ever been: Restaurants are drizzling the dressing on anything and everything, and Trader Joe's fans love it so much, the grocery chain now sells a seasoning mix, dip and even a green goddess - flavored gouda. TikTokers have had their way with green goddess too: The founder of Baked by Melissa, Melissa Ben-Ishay, posted a green goddess chopped salad that has racked up 21 million views and counting. These days, the name green goddess can apply to any variety of herby salad dressing, but the original recipe - invented at San Francisco's Palace Hotel in 1923 - included chives, anchovies, scallions and parsley. SALAD WITH CREAM DRESSING



Salad With Cream Dressing image

The inspiration for this salad that my wife prepares occasionally at home comes from the area of France where I was raised, near Lyon. It is always better done at home; the dressing lends itself to individual rather than high-volume preparation, and the delicacy required to properly clean and thoroughly dry the greens without bruising them is more easily achieved in the home kitchen. The salad should be cool but not ice cold, and should be tossed at the last minute, just before serving, especially if Boston or red-tipped leaf lettuce is used.

GREEN SALAD WITH RADISHES AND CREAMY MUSTARD DRESSING



Green Salad with Radishes and Creamy Mustard Dressing image

Made creamy with sieved egg yolk, this dressing is also especially delicious when spooned over sliced beets or boiled and cooled asparagus, green beans, or cauliflower.

Steps:

  • For the dressing:
  • In a medium saucepan, bring a few inches of water to a boil. Using a slotted spoon, gently lower in the eggs and cook for 9 minutes (or 8 minutes if you like the yolk a little softer). While the eggs cook, set up a bowl of ice water in the sink; transfer the just boiled eggs to the ice bath.
  • Allow the eggs to cool in ice water, then peel them and separate the yolks from the whites. Reserve the whites for another use and push the yolks through a a sieve or a "spider" spatula into a medium mixing bowl. Add the mustard, vinegar, lemon juice, salt, and pepper; stir until smooth. Gradually whisk in the oil, creating a creamy, mayo-like emulsion with a bit more texture. Season and add additional lemon juice to taste.
  • For the salad:
  • Put the lettuces and radishes in a salad bowl and spoon over most of the dressing. Season with a sprinkle of salt and freshly cracked black pepper. Gently but thoroughly toss the salad with your hands to coat the leaves well. Taste a leaf and add more dressing, lemon, salt, or pepper as needed. Serve immediately.
